The Story of the Work
Celestial Drift is a contemplative work in the JeanElton OvalVase (OV) Collection. With its deep matte surface, this tall vessel suggests the shifting patterns of a distant nebula or the gentle eddy of stardust adrift in space. Hazy layers of violet, indigo, charcoal, and pale silver give way to clusters of hand-dotted constellations—each tiny sphere suggesting an orbit, a presence, a gravitational pull.
The gently undulating rim further enhances the sense of upward drift, like a soft atmospheric wave reaching beyond the bounds of the vessel’s form. The matte finish on both the interior and exterior allows for a visual softness that invites close study and quiet reflection.
The work is fired first to approximately 1800 degrees F, after which any remaining fine alterations are made, and the surface treatment is applied by hand by the artist. A second firing to about 2100 degrees F completes the process, ensuring its durability and artistic integrity.
This piece bears the JeanElton signature on its underside and comes with a Certificate of Authenticity (COA), both of which display its catalogue reference.
